Ingredients

serves 6
  • 2 pounds baby red potatoes
  • 6 slices bacon
  • 1 small yellow onion (chopped)
  • ¼ cup white wine vinegar (or apple cider vinegar)
  • 1 tablespoon honey (or granulated sugar)
  • 2 teaspoons Dijon mustard (optional)
  • ¾ teaspoon salt (or to taste, plus more for cooking the potatoes)
  • ¼ teaspoon black pepper (or to taste)
  • ¼ cup chopped fresh parsley
